Unit G-Mark-1,[1] known to the Utaru as Fa, was a unique machine in Horizon Forbidden West.
History[]
Unit G-Mark-1 was originally one of the eight Plowhorns responsible for maintaining the land near Regional Control Center 9, making the soil extremely fertile and bountiful. This work was only interrupted by a yearly visit to Repair-Bay TAU for routine maintenance.[2]
When the first Utaru came across the land and settled there, they named it Plainsong and came to see the local Plowhorns as "land-gods", worshipping them and decorating them with handprints and ornaments of worship, as well as marking their visits to TAU (which they called the sacred cave) as the eight hallowed festivals of their calendar. As they returned from the sacred cave clean and restored two days later, with no sign of any decoration from the Utaru, this reinforced their belief in the natural cycle of the world.[2] They were named after sounds derived from solfeggio, a method of marking musical intonation, with G-Mark-1 being named Fa.
This cycle continued for generations, until the Derangement began, when the land-gods stopped visiting the sacred cave for maintenance, causing them to eventually start breaking down and malfunction. They started glutting Plainsong endlessly with mulch, eventually allowing the Red Blight to start spreading in the region, causing a widespread food shortage among the Utaru.[2]
Three weeks prior to Aloy meeting Zo, Fa returned to the sacred cave. This raised the local tribe's hopes that the cycle was restarting, but after three weeks, this hope was lost.[2]
Horizon Forbidden West[]
After some resistance from the Chorus, Aloy, Varl and Zo entered the sacred cave and TAU, eventually finding Fa, converted by HEPHAESTUS into a Grimhorn. Zo, fearing the Utarus' reaction to being attacked by one of their land-gods, hesitantly agreed that they had to destroy it. HEPHAESTUS released Fa against the three intruders, alongside several other machines, but they failed to stop them and were all destroyed, while HEPHAESTUS was purged from TAU by Aloy.[3]

Trivia[]
- Fa is seen as female to the Utaru, as Zo uses she/her pronouns for Fa, while Aloy and Varl, seeing Fa as just a machine, use it/that pronouns.[2]
- Fa has less HP than other Grimhorns. This could be because it wasn't finished with its construction, or purely to prevent the battle from being too difficult at that point in the game.
